Output 3694e7c4630cfbf3c94f674f32d259f3c3d7cf60ffd3cd857322e30d0ff82f30:0

value
17615309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0e10f40e13a67bc79d6d1f9e526afde5be01858 OP_EQUAL
address
3LjU5rkFb8VvGqm6HFL4SQHzz3vjCdEDfQ
transaction
3694e7c4630cfbf3c94f674f32d259f3c3d7cf60ffd3cd857322e30d0ff82f30
spent
true